Understanding Emulsifiers: The Scientific Research Behind the Blend
Emulsifiers are usually neglected in day-to-day cooking and food manufacturing, they play an essential role in supporting mixes that would otherwise divide. Emulsifiers are compounds that reduce surface stress in between 2 immiscible fluids, such as oil and water. They possess both hydrophilic (water-attracting) and hydrophobic (water-repelling) homes, enabling them to interact with both stages. This one-of-a-kind characteristic allows emulsifiers to create a steady interface, stopping the splitting up of liquids and fats.
Usual instances of emulsifiers include lecithin, typically obtained from eggs or soybeans, and mono- and diglycerides. These compounds develop an uniform texture in products like mayonnaise, salad dressings, and sauces. The science behind emulsifiers lies in their capability to produce a secure solution, which is vital for accomplishing preferable food top quality and life span. Kinds of Emulsifiers: Synthetic vs. all-natural
Understanding the distinctions in between synthetic and natural emulsifiers is important for formulators aiming to enhance cosmetic items. All-natural emulsifiers, stemmed from plant or pet sources, consist of active ingredients like lecithin, beeswax, and various gums. They are commonly preferred for their skin-friendly buildings and biodegradability. Furthermore, they can boost the sensory profile of formulations, giving a more enticing appearance and really feel.
In contrast, synthetic emulsifiers are chemically engineered to create specific functionalities and stability. Typical instances consist of polysorbates and stearic acid. These emulsifiers commonly offer superior efficiency regarding emulsification effectiveness and shelf-life security. However, they may elevate concerns pertaining to skin level of sensitivity and ecological impact.

Selecting the Right Emulsifier

Picking the appropriate emulsifier can substantially improve the texture and security of a mix, as the right choice depends on the certain components and preferred result. Different factors influence this decision, including the type of fats or oils, the visibility of water, and the target consistency. For example, lecithin is optimal for dressings and sauces, while xanthan gum functions well in gluten-free baking. In addition, the emulsifier's compatibility with various other components plays a significant duty in attaining the wanted security. It is important to consider the temperature level variety of the application, as some emulsifiers execute better under specific conditions.
